As a Lead Software Engineer at JPMorgan Chase within the award-winning Vida team that is part of the Corporate and Investment Bank Markets Business, you play a crucial role in an agile team dedicated to enhancing, building, and delivering reliable, market-leading technology products with a focus on security, stability, and scalability.
Job responsibilities:
- Executes creative software solutions, design, development, and technical troubleshooting with ability to think beyond routine or conventional approaches to build solutions or break down technical problems.
- Develops secure high-quality production code, and reviews and debugs code written by others.
- Identifies opportunities to eliminate or automate remediation of recurring issues to improve overall operational stability of software applications and systems.
- Leads evaluation sessions with external vendors, startups, and internal teams to drive outcomes-oriented probing of architectural designs, technical credentials, and applicability for use within existing systems and information architecture.
- Leads communities of practice across Software Engineering to drive awareness and use of new and leading-edge technologies.
- Adds to team culture of diversity, opportunity, inclusion, and respect.
- Drives team adoption of enterprise-authorized AI-assisted engineering practices within the work environment to improve code quality, delivery speed, and operational outcomes.
- Applies knowledge of tools within the Software Development Life Cycle toolchain, including enterprise-authorized AI-assisted development and automation capabilities, to improve the value realized by automation.
Required qualifications, capabilities, and skills:
- Significant commercial experience developing UIs with hands-on applied experience developing in React.
- Hands-on practical experience delivering system design, application development, testing, and operational stability.
- Advanced in one or more programming language(s).
- Proficiency in automation and continuous delivery methods.
- Proficient in all aspects of the Software Development Life Cycle.
- Advanced understanding of agile methodologies such as CI/CD, Application Resiliency, and Security.
- Demonstrated proficiency in software applications and technical processes within a technical discipline (e.g., cloud, artificial intelligence, machine learning, mobile, etc.).
- In-depth knowledge of the financial services industry and their IT systems.
- Practical cloud native experience.
- Experience in developing, debugging and automated testing (e.g. react testing library / cypress) within a commercial setting.
- Experience collaborating with backend technology teams in designing scalable and reusable RESTful APIs.
- Demonstrated experience leading effective use of approved AI-assisted software development tools.
- Strong understanding of responsible AI use in engineering workflows, including data sensitivity considerations, secure handling of inputs/outputs, and adherence to resiliency and security expectations.
Preferred qualifications, capabilities, and skills:
- Exposure to frontend libraries such as ag-grid, highcharts, redux as well as Typescript.
- Exposure to performance tuning complex UIs would be advantageous.
- Working within Investment Bank / Finance Technology.
- Team leading experience.
